Keppel Land ups stake in Vietnam's Saigon Centre
Singapore
KEPPEL Land on Sunday said it has acquired an additional 16 per cent stake in the joint venture (JV) entities for Saigon Centre in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am, for a sum of 845.9 billion Vietnamese dong (S$53.5 million) in cash to be funded by internal financial resources. The seller is Keppel Land's Vietnamese partner, Southern Waterborne Transport Corporation,
Following the purchase, Keppel Land has raised its aggregate interest in the JV companies for Saigon Centre Phases One and Two from about 45.3 per cent to 53.5 per cent, and its aggregate interest in the JV companies for subsequent phases of Saigon Centre from 68 per cent to 76.2 per cent.
